Times have changed at such a fast rate
With technology I don’t understand
I feel like an alien in my own world
Im so completely out of date!
Oh, for the simple days of little frustration
When the t.v had four channels and it was free
You had to physically turn the t.v knob
Disputing who’s turn it was to get up and change the station
When the family phone was attached to a wall
For the whole family to use
It was big ,clunky with a rotary dial
And all it could do was call
When a camera was used to take photos
That had a film roll inside
To take to the chemist to get developed
In either “matt or gloss” to pick up in a week or so
When correspondence was hand written or typed
Enclosed in an envelope with stamp then mailed
Music was played on a record player or radio
Dishes were hand washed and wiped
Now it’s all computerised
With passwords and codes
Beeping, flashing and telling you NO
Kept in clouds in the sky!!
I know technology and progress are a need
And one has to move with the times
There are so many positives and benefits
But I miss those uncomplicated , simple days indeed!
